Leave Zurich at 8:30 a.m. for Interlaken, Lauterbrunnen, and Jungfraujoch, Europe’s highest railway station. You’ll ride a cogwheel train and the Eiger Express, visit the Ice Palace and Sphinx Observatory, and return by coach. Guides vary, with Kid and Raymond among the praised leaders.

From central Lucerne, ride a panoramic gondola and Dragon Ride to Mount Pilatus, enjoy free time at 2,132 meters, descend by cogwheel train, then cruise Lake Lucerne from Alpnachstad. The English tour lasts about 5 hours 15 minutes and includes transport and admissions.

Leave Zurich at 1:15 pm by air-conditioned coach for Rhine Falls and Castle Laufen, then walk through mural-covered Stein am Rhein. A multilingual guide such as Francesca, Bjorn, or Monika provides commentary. The optional summer boat ride costs CHF 12 and gets you close to the spray.

Start in Bönigen with a guide such as Ben, Sona, or Ryan, learn basic paddling, then cross the Lütschine River toward cliffs, beaches, and Ringgenberg Castle. You spend about two hours on Lake Brienz, with kayaks, safety gear, and photos included.
